Analysis Summary

Elon Musk asserts that civil war in Britain is inevitable, framing it as a matter of timing amid ongoing social and political tensions. This prediction is highly speculative and lacks empirical support, drawing criticism from UK officials and experts who emphasize government stability and historical precedents against such escalation. Opposing views highlight effective law enforcement responses to recent unrest and the absence of widespread armed conflict indicators.
